Be careful when adding your basslines, it can seriously fuck your shit up. It may sound bassy as fuck on your computer speakers, but it could be a distorted sound wave and screw your coils. I made a track that was a slammer on my studio monitors but I had way too much distortion on it(Dubsteppin' sheit) and I didn't eq it right and after 30 seconds my subs starting getting stinky

This, IF you don't have a sub for your computer, You need to be very careful. My speakers don't have crossovers on my computer, so i can just put my finger on the surround to tell how much bass is coming through, but on a car sub, it will usually be to much so i have to go back and reduce it. A long process :| Also, Refer to any of purplesyrups or decafs remixes, look how much bass those have on computer speakers compared to what you have. It doesn't take much
